Abstract

The invention discloses an integrated storage-type bottle cap. The integrated storage-type bottle cap comprises a bottle cap body, a storage bin, a semi-spherical bulge, an opener and an aluminum foilsealing film, wherein the storage bin is arranged on the inner side of the bottle cap body; the upper end of the storage bin and the bottle cap body are integrally connected; the bottom end of the storage bin is opened and extends to be below the bottom end of the bottle cap body; an assembly gap is formed between the storage bin and the bottle cap body; the semi-spherical bulge is formed at theupper end of the storage bin; the opener is arranged on the inner side of the storage bin; the upper end of the opener and the semi-spherical bulge are integrally connected; the length of the opener is slightly smaller than that of the storage bin; and the aluminum foil sealing film is connected to the bottom of the storage bin in a heat-sealing manner. A powdery, granular or liquid material is stored in the storage bin; during eating or drinking, the semi-spherical bulge at the upper part of the bottle cap is pressed to open the storage bin, such that the material is injected into a bottle body to be mixed with a liquid for dissolution; and no preservative needs to be added, so that a healthy and convenient drink free from the preservative can be obtained.

Description

technical field [0001] The invention relates to a bottle cap, in particular to an integrated storage type bottle cap. Background technique [0002] Food safety is related to everyone, and how unhealthy beverages devour everyone's health can be seen every day on the Internet. At present, the functional drinks on the market are all blended before leaving the factory. In order to preserve them for a long time, it is necessary to add appropriate preservatives to the drinks. We all know that foods with added preservatives are not very healthy and natural foods. In various probiotic drinks, in order to maintain the activity of the probiotics in them, they are usually transported at low temperature and stored at low temperature for sale. Such a method undoubtedly increases the cost of sales; if exposed to light for a long time, it is very easy to change the chlorophyll, lutein and other edible items of the character.
